In return, we promise to provide support, opportunities and performance-led financial rewards at a workplace where you can shape the future, win as a team and grow with us.About The RoleWe’re looking for a Claims Representative III, Accident Benefits handling basic claims to join our growing teamThis opportunity can be based in any of the following Intact Ontario office locations: Ajax/London/Mississauga/Ottawa/Richmond Hill/Toronto (700 University Ave).What You'll Do HereAnalyze and interpret insurance policy wording to determine coverage and assess entitlements which are fair and equitable.Communicate in a timely and respectful manner with the customer, claimants, lawyers and insurers to settle claims and report findings and settlements.Conduct investigations and identify additional information such as independent medical examinations, customers medical or employment history required to clarify and/or justify a claim.Collect reports and statements to determine liability and coverage.Ensure all cases are clearly documented and meet any or all legislative requirements.Assist junior staff with day-to-day issues, escalating more serious issues to senior specialists, consultant or management staff.What You Bring To The TableUniversity degree or any combination of training and experience deemed relevant for the roleA minimum of 3 years of experience as Adjuster Accident Benefits claims.Ability to communicate and negotiate effectively.Excellent written and verbal communication skills.Strong analytical and decision-making skills.Knowledge of the provincial legislation governing auto insurance.Pursuing your Chartered Insurance Professional (CIP) designation is an asset.This role is eligible for employee referral bonus. #myReferrals3000What We OfferOur hybrid work model provides the balance between working from home and enjoying meaningful in-person interactions.Working Here Means You'll Be Empowered To Be And Do Your Best Every Day.
